Given Input numbers are 743, 455, 71, 588
To find the GCD of numbers using factoring list out all the divisors of each number
Divisors of 743
List of positive integer divisors of 743 that divides 743 without a remainder.
1, 743
Divisors of 455
List of positive integer divisors of 455 that divides 455 without a remainder.
1, 5, 7, 13, 35, 65, 91, 455
Divisors of 71
List of positive integer divisors of 71 that divides 71 without a remainder.
1, 71
Divisors of 588
List of positive integer divisors of 588 that divides 588 without a remainder.
1, 2, 3, 4, 6, 7, 12, 14, 21, 28, 42, 49, 84, 98, 147, 196, 294, 588
Greatest Common Divisior
We found the divisors of 743, 455, 71, 588 . The biggest common divisior number is the GCD number.
So the Greatest Common Divisior 743, 455, 71, 588 is 1.
Therefore, GCD of numbers 743, 455, 71, 588 is 1
Given Input Data is 743, 455, 71, 588
Make a list of Prime Factors of all the given numbers initially
Prime Factorization of 743 is 743
Prime Factorization of 455 is 5 x 7 x 13
Prime Factorization of 71 is 71
Prime Factorization of 588 is 2 x 2 x 3 x 7 x 7
The above numbers do not have any common prime factor. So GCD is 1
